Carl Rogers
An influential American psychologist who founded the humanistic approach to psychology and developed client-centered therapy.
Psychoticism
A personality pattern typified by aggressiveness and interpersonal hostility, and in the context of mental illness, can refer to a tendency towards psychosis.
Big Five
A model describing five major dimensions of human personality traits: openness, conscientiousness, extraversion, agreeableness, and neuroticism.
Peak Experiences
Moments of extreme positive emotion and fulfillment, often associated with self-actualization and personal growth.
